Common Causes of AC Water Leaks
AC water leaks stem from several interconnected factors. Water collected from the air during cooling processes must be expelled. Malfunctions in the drainage system, condensation buildup, or issues with the unit’s internal components can lead to leaks. In some cases, external factors, like improper installation or clogged drainage lines, are also responsible.
Types of AC Units and Leak Manifestations
Different AC unit types experience leaks in distinct ways. Window units, for example, often leak water directly onto the floor or surrounding surfaces. Split-system units, featuring indoor and outdoor components, might exhibit leaks from the indoor unit or the condensate pan, which collects excess water. Central AC units, with their intricate ductwork and drainage systems, can exhibit leaks in various locations, including the drain pan or the ductwork itself.
Understanding the type of unit is crucial in diagnosing the leak’s origin.

Troubleshooting Table: Common AC Water Leak Causes
Cause | Symptom | Potential Solutions |
---|---|---|
Clogged condensate drain line | Water accumulating around the unit, slow draining, or no drainage at all. | Clear the drain line, ensure proper slope, and consider a drain pump if necessary. |
Faulty condensate pump | Inability to drain collected water, potentially leading to water buildup in the unit or surrounding areas. | Inspect the pump for clogs or damage, replace if necessary. |
Damaged condensate pan | Leaks directly from the pan, possibly leading to extensive water damage. | Replace the condensate pan if damaged or cracked. |
Improper installation | Leaks in various locations due to incorrect positioning or connections. | Consult a qualified HVAC technician for a proper installation and check connections. |
Condensation buildup issues | Excessive water buildup and potential leaks from the unit. | Ensure proper ventilation and air circulation around the unit, and check for obstructions. |

Function of the Water Pan and Drain Line
The water pan is a shallow tray positioned beneath the evaporator coil. The evaporator coil, in the cooling process, absorbs heat from the air, causing water vapor in the air to condense. This condensed water collects in the pan. The drain line is a tube connected to the water pan, designed to carry the collected water away from the unit and into a designated drainage system.
This prevents water from accumulating and potentially causing damage.
Inspecting the Water Pan and Drain Line
Regular inspection is crucial for maintaining the system. Visually inspect the pan for any signs of leaks, damage, or excessive buildup. Check the drain line for blockages, kinks, or obstructions. Look for signs of corrosion, especially at joints or connections.
How Clogs Lead to Leaks
Clogs in the drain line or pan can prevent water from draining properly. This buildup of water puts pressure on the pan, potentially causing leaks around the pan or through the drain line itself. Furthermore, the excess water can overflow, leading to damage to surrounding surfaces. Water pooling in the pan can also lead to mold or mildew growth.
Cleaning and Unclogging the Water Pan and Drain Line
A clogged drain line or pan needs immediate attention. First, carefully disconnect the drain line from the pan. Use a flexible drain snake or a plunger to clear any clogs. Thoroughly clean the pan using a mild detergent and water. Inspect for any damage or cracks, and repair or replace as necessary.
Once cleaned, reconnect the drain line. Verify proper drainage.

Troubleshooting Drain Line Problems, Why does my ac leak water
Problem | Description | Solution |
---|---|---|
Blockages | Obstructions in the drain line preventing water flow. | Use a drain snake or plunger to clear the blockage. If the blockage is persistent, consult a professional. |
Kinks | Bends or sharp turns in the drain line restricting water flow. | Straighten or replace the kinked section of the drain line. If the kink is severe, consult a professional. |
Improper Installation | Faulty connections or improper placement of the drain line. | Reinstall the drain line correctly, ensuring proper connections and drainage. If the problem persists, consult a qualified technician. |
Corrosion | Deterioration of the drain line material, causing leaks or blockages. | Replace the corroded section of the drain line. Consult a professional for replacement and inspection of the entire drain line. |

Improper Installation
Poor installation practices are a frequent cause of AC water leaks. Inaccurate positioning of the unit, especially concerning drainage lines, can lead to water accumulation. Incorrectly sized drain lines or insufficient slope can also result in water pooling around the unit. Furthermore, improper sealing of connections can lead to leaks over time. A poorly installed unit is a recipe for ongoing problems, especially with seasonal changes and weather fluctuations.

Surrounding Moisture
High humidity levels and excessive moisture in the surrounding environment can increase the amount of condensation generated by the AC unit. This excess moisture can overwhelm the drain system, leading to leaks. Ground water near the unit can also saturate the soil, impacting drainage and contributing to water pooling. Factors such as nearby landscaping, including sprinklers or irrigation systems, can exacerbate these issues.
Drainage Issues
Proper drainage is essential for preventing water buildup around the AC unit. Obstructions in the drain lines, such as debris or clogs, can hinder the flow of water away from the unit. Flat or uneven ground around the unit can also prevent proper drainage. A clogged or improperly sloping drain line will lead to water backing up, creating a significant risk for leaks.
Regular maintenance and checks are necessary to ensure proper drainage flow.
Weather Conditions
Extreme weather conditions can significantly impact the likelihood of AC water leaks. Heavy rainfall can overwhelm the drainage system, leading to water pooling. Prolonged periods of high humidity can increase condensation levels, putting strain on the drain system. Importance of Outdoor Drainage
Maintaining proper outdoor drainage around the AC unit is critical for preventing water leaks. Ensure the ground slopes away from the unit to allow water to flow freely. Regularly inspect the area for any obstructions that might hinder drainage. This proactive approach will minimize the risk of water damage and prevent potential leaks.
Checking Ground Drainage
Inspecting the ground around the AC unit for proper drainage is a crucial preventative measure. Look for any low spots or areas where water tends to accumulate. Ensure that the ground slopes away from the unit in all directions. A simple visual inspection can uncover potential drainage problems before they escalate into significant leaks. Use a garden hose or a small amount of water to test the flow of water away from the unit during a period of light rainfall.
